Community route (mapped on AllTrails) — not part of Madeira's official PR trail network managed by IFCN, the regional government's forests and nature-conservation authority, so it has no official open/closed status and no maintenance/signage guarantee. Check access and conditions locally before going.

The loop starts at the Miradouro do Pico do Facho picnic area, north of Machico, which gives sweeping views over the Machico valley, the central peaks of the island, the Desertas Islands, and Ponta de São Lourenço.
Pico do Facho itself has historical significance — in the past, large bonfires (facho = beacon/torch) were lit here to alert the population to the approach of enemy ships.
From the summit, the trail descends through paths leading down toward Machico beach and the Forte de Nossa Senhora do Amparo, a small triangular fort whose seaward angle faces the ocean, with a Baroque pediment over its landward gatehouse. The route then loops back along the Machico stream and seafront.
